Я пытаюсь настроить Rasperry Pi для использования в качестве домашнего DNS-сервера и DHCP-сервера, используя dnsmasq. Теперь все устройства в сети (около 20) используют этот сервер DHCP и DNS, и они получают фиксированные IP-адреса и могут разрешать имена друг друга. Работает довольно хорошо

Для своих детей я установил OpenDNS Родительский контроль DNS в качестве восходящего DNS. Но теперь все устройства получают эту фильтрацию DNS.

Можно ли настроить dnsmasq для отправки DNS-адресов родительского контроля только на устройства моих детей, но не на остальные?

1 ответ1

1

dnsmasq может сделать это с помощью сетевых тегов.

В dnsmasq.conf добавьте параметры:

dhcp-host=<hostname and/or mac>,192.168.0.50
dhcp-range=pc,192.168.0.50, 192.168.0.60
dhcp-option=pc,6,<opendns ip>

Ips в диапазоне 192.168.0.50 - 192.168.0.60 получат Open DNS в качестве своего DNS-сервера.

Вы не можете специально настроить DNS-сервер для переадресации по-разному, в зависимости от сети, для которой вам потребуется настроить два отдельных сервера пересылки, если вы также хотите, чтобы маршрутизатор управлял DNS на узлах родительского контроля.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.